Account recovery — Fontbarrow vendoring pipeline

Hey release manager — if the build account for Quillgate gets locked mid-release, don't panic. The vendored third-party fonts live in the sealed artifact cache, so a recovery won't re-fetch anything from upstream; licenses stay intact. Run the unlock script, re-link the font manifest, and double-check the checksums match last release's snapshot before cutting anything new. The unlock script will stall at the vault prompt until you supply the recovery passphrase printed directly below.

unlock words, tawif-tahop: oliys-ulawyn-tamdor-lamys-casox-jormir-fraius-kasath-ulador-ulamir-holir-sorys-holeth

Subject: Partner SFTP drop — new owner

Hi,

As you review the pending changes to the Harborline ingest scripts, note that ownership of the partner SFTP drop is changing at the end of the month. This includes key rotation, the nightly pull job, and the quarantine folder for malformed files. Review comments on the retry logic should still go through the normal PR flow, but questions about drop-folder conventions or partner onboarding now go to the new owner. The incoming owner is listed below.

signatory, tagaf-bahaf: Praael Fenmir Rusok

Ticket: Staging env misconfigured for Siftgate bloom filter

The bloom layer in front of the Pellet KV store is rejecting all lookups in staging because the env file was copied from the dev template without credentials. False-positive tuning values are fine; only the auth line is missing. To unblock the weekly demo, the Pellet admission secret must be set on the following line.

env line for yaguf-fajop: LEDGER_TOKEN13=fb08984397349

## Tracing Requests Across Services

Every request through the Wrenbay stack carries a trace ID from the edge gateway down to the billing workers, so you can follow a customer's journey hop by hop. Traces get sampled, but metadata for every hop lands in the trace index. To poke at it directly, use the connection string below.

primary connection of tajeg-tajop = postgresql://julax_svc:DI@db-e7f3.kelvidyn.corp:5432/rusdor